On
Mohsin-ul-Muli's request the Aga Khan led a deputation to the Viceroy at Simla on October
1, 1906. A constitutional provision was made conceding separate electorates to the
Muslims.
Mohsin-ul-Mulik
set up the Urdu Defence Association to protect the legitimate claims of Urdu.
Nawab
Viqar-ul-Mulk served all public causes which were in the best interest of the
Muslims. He presided over a meeting of leading Muslims at Dacca on December 30, 1906 that
laid the foundation of the All India Muslim League.
